In doing so, he will elicit participation from the worldwide Infonet operations that provide local service and support for clients in 54 nations, from the provider's customers who comprise 24 percent of Business Week's top Global 1,000 list, and from its suppliers and other business partners. Kimball originally joined Infonet in 1992 as a director of customer services. Before that, he was a principal with the Advantage Group, an independent consulting firm dedicated to helping companies fine-tune their customer service organizations. Infonet Services is a world leader in providing reliable, state-of-the-art international communication solutions to global enterprises. Infonet specializes in value-added services and managed networks, which are supported locally in 54 countries. Infonet's World Network is currently accessible in more than 165 countries.
